Up for sale is a highly collectible piece of Fender history: a rare 1981–1982 Fender Collector's Edition "Black & Gold" Telecaster, bearing serial number CE 11367. Built during the famous transitional era at the Fullerton, California plant, this gorgeous instrument features the highly desirable, snappy one-piece maple neck and fingerboard option.Fender produced these luxury "Collector's Edition" guitars in very limited numbers (estimated at around 500 total units). This model represents a unique chapter where Fender focused heavily on high-end appointments and heavy-mass hardware to maximize sustain and tone.
